How many milliliters of 0.281 M NaCl solution must be measured to obtain 0.177 mol of NaCl?

Chemistry
1 answer:
Usimov [2.4K]2 years ago
5 0

Answer:

630 mL

Explanation:

0.281 M = 0.281 mol/L

0.177 mol /0.281 mol/L =0.630 L

0.630 L=630 mL
